Output 99544f75c136eb94addfd72791f143e67a0e6dc7ec93e94358a96f1fb0ff43c0:1

value
66925443
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 c0cc64a06ea919006e7cb7c6e8776f8de2f9e942 OP_EQUALVERIFY OP_CHECKSIG
address
1JaRbK3cXKTmnbzag46BkptbuAXMaXz1E9
transaction
99544f75c136eb94addfd72791f143e67a0e6dc7ec93e94358a96f1fb0ff43c0
spent
true